Malaysia is having an environmental problem in disposing palm oil fuel ash (POFA) which is a byproduct of palm oil mill since many years ago. Due to this concern, it may be utilized in a concrete as one of the supplementary cementatious material (SCM). This research is to study its setting time of each sample by replacement of cement using liquidation and powder technique. The replacement percentage used for this research is 5% POFA and 10% POFA. Through this research, mixture with 5% POFA using liquidation technique has the highest setting time. © 2018 Author(s).
